They believed that self-discipline made them better warriors. To improve their discipline, many samurai participated in peaceful rituals that required great concentration. Some created intricate flower arrangements or grew miniature bonsai trees.

Orange juice will keep cut flowers alive only for a short time. The sugars in the orange juice will become a source of food for bacteria which will begin to clog the stem of the flower and not allow it to take in the water for its needs.

It can happen because the different number of chromosomes in parent species results in an odd number of chromosomes for the offspring, leading to problems with genome distribution in sexual cells.
This happens, for example, with mules.
